Transaction 388528242fee96b596aa715dd3387b66c85045d375d137129dbf3a284830360f

1 Input
2 Outputs
  • 388528242fee96b596aa715dd3387b66c85045d375d137129dbf3a284830360f:0
  • value  43438914
    address  18Rka1FgxRh3m1VCbNiF2iSF1YKqaBYA5J
  • 388528242fee96b596aa715dd3387b66c85045d375d137129dbf3a284830360f:1
  • value  127492000
    address  12AjRitLeYCcBMDjnQtaxuNE87LJtcPqVe